  THIRD SECTION DECISION Application no. 41891/22 Edmond MALLAJ against Greece and 4 other applications (see appended table) The European Court of Human Rights (Third Section), sitting on 18 December 2025 as a Committee composed of:  Diana Kovatcheva, President,  Canòlic Mingorance Cairat,  Vasilka Sancin, judges, and Viktoriya Maradudina, Acting Deputy Section Registrar, Having regard to the above applications lodged on the various dates indicated in the appended table, Having deliberated, decides as follows: FACTS AND PROCEDURE The list of the applicants and the relevant details are set out in the appendix. The applicants were represented by Mr K. Tsitselikis and Mr A. Spathis, two lawyers practising in Thessaloniki. The applicants’ complaints under Article 3 of the Convention concerning the inadequate conditions of detention, as well as under Article 13 of the Convention concerning the lack of any effective remedy in domestic law in respect of inadequate conditions of detention were communicated to the Greek Government (“the Government”). On the various dates indicated in the appended table the applicants informed the Registry that they wanted to withdraw the applications to the Court. THE LAW Having regard to the similar subject matter of the applications, the Court finds it appropriate to examine them jointly in a single decision. In the light of the foregoing, the Court concludes that the applicants may be regarded as no longer wishing to pursue the applications (Article 37 § 1 (a) of the Convention). Furthermore, in accordance with Article 37 § 1 in fine, the Court finds no special circumstances regarding respect for human rights as defined in the Convention and the Protocols thereto which require the continued examination of the applications. Accordingly, the cases should be struck out of the list. For these reasons, the Court, unanimously, Decides to join the applications; Decides to strike the applications out of its list of cases.
